Georges-Vanier Cultural Center
Our mission

The Georges-Vanier Cultural Center’s mission is to encourge cultural practice by promoting creativity, exchange and the exploration of the arts in the community.
Our vision
Eager to establish links and exchanges between the public and cultural professionals, the CCGV proposes three sessions of programming each year. Classes, studio-workshops, conferences, exhibits, events and cultural mediation, in the visual arts, music and movement. In this way, the CCGV hopes to contribute to the improvement of the quality of life in the community while basking in the cultural brilliance of the Southwest borough.
Our values
Considering it essential that culture be shared throughout the social environment and in co-operation with other groups having a cultural mission, the CCGV values the well-being of its clientele and staff. We wish to offer you a warm and welcoming environment in which to be creative, where quality is the key to success.

The administration
Initially managed by the Association culturelle du Sud-Ouest ( ACSO), the CCGV has been managed by the non-profit organisation, Voies Parallèles, Corporation de développement culturel du Sud-Ouest since January 1st, 2009.
